    The first is what happened when the lady in the picture managed to drive her metro into the paddock at Knockhill during a Ferrari open day, god knows how but anyway, she parked up, exited the car and walked away not realising she had left her handbrake off. We heard a shout and a scream when the metro was rolling down the paddock about to squash the little girl. The owner of the 348 jumped to the rescue and pulled her aside as the metro decided to whack his car. All turned out well in the end, just dont let metros into Ferrari open days.
